Softball Held Off By Bowdoin, St. Mary's (IN) In Final Day Of Cusic Classic

FORT MYERS, FL, March 11, 2009 - Elms College junior shortstop Allyson Graffum (Ipswich, MA) went 2 for 4 with two RBI in game one and the Blazers received solid pitching performances from freshman Courtney Hampton (Westfield, MA) and sophomore Ani Ramsdell (Gardner, MA), but fell 4-3 in eight innings to Bowdoin and 3-1 to St. Mary's (IN) in the final day of the Gene Cusic Classic on Wednesday at Fort Myers, Florida.

In the first game against Bowdoin, Graffum delivered a RBI single in the seventh to send the game to extra innings.

Although the Blazers plated a run in their half of the eighth, the Polar Bears (1-0) scored twice to seal the victory.

Ramsdell was the hard-luck loser for the Blazers despite allowing just three earned runs and five hits over 7.1 innings.

Against St. Mary's (IN), Hampton was also the tough-luck loser, although she yielded just one earned run on six hits in the complete-game effort.

Junior left fielder Kim Lastowski (Turners Falls, MA) belted a RBI double to tie the game at 1-1 in the fifth, but St. Mary's scored two runs in its final at-bat to secure the victory.

Elms College returns to non-conference play on Thursday, March 26 when it hosts Westfield State in its home opener at Condon Field. Game time is 4:00 p.m.
